usb: remove misleading usb_device_get_mapped_ep

Even though this method may seem very convenient to use, it's actually
wrong. The devices are usually not required to have strict endpoint
numbers. That's why the mapping mechanism exists. Therefore, it's just
not possible to rely on fixed endpoint mapping.

There could be similar method, that would take the transfer type and
direction, but it's much better to ask for the complete mapping then.
